What the server does

  • List local nf-core repositories (rnaseq, sarek, modules, tools)
  • Access pipeline configurations and workflows
  • Search through pipeline files
  • Explore pipeline modules

How to install the Nf Core MCP MCP server

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"nf-core":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["-y", "nf-core-mcp"]
    }
  }
}

Add to claude_desktop_config.json, then restart Claude Desktop.
